Where XCR is, and how to track it

Toronto, OntarioTransport Canada records the base city, so this marker shows the province rather than the exact field.

XCR transmits ADS-B under the 24-bit address C03D02. Trackers key on that address rather than the tail number, so it finds the aircraft even on flights flown under a different callsign. Transport Canada assigns the address against the registration, so it changes if the aircraft is re-registered.

Most private aircraft are on the ground most of the time — if a tracker shows nothing, it is very likely parked rather than missing.
